International Women’s Day - Let Them Play

Before the reception begins between 4pm and 6pm there will be cage football and skill demonstrations from our regional excellence girls taking place outside parliament buildings.

Sue O’Neill – Chairperson of NIWFAcommented, “I am delighted to celebrate 40 years of the NIWFA with so many great women who have contributed to the success of women’s football in Northern Ireland.”

Michael Boyd, Irish FA Director of Football Development added, “It is fantastic to be celebrating 40 years of the Northern Ireland Women’s Football Association today at Stormont with support from the DCAL Minister. We have set ambitious targets for growing girls and women’s football across Northern Ireland over the next ten years in our youth strategy Let Them Play and our Girls/Women’s Plan. The NIWFA have championed the promotion of girls and women’s football over the last 40yrs, not just in participation terms but in the social well-being of girls and women in football. I want to take this opportunity to thank the NIWFA and all the volunteers in the girls/women’s game for their drive growing and sustaining the game here. We look forward to working in partnership with them over the next 40 years!”
